Output 38222914e6014c72478ef7b83ba56d2229ca00502663928c945fb9570e9c6634:0

value
915279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8dce77836efaab6960baa3cca871e466da1f34a OP_EQUAL
address
3L15hbpjCUp6VQCCEAEzWTjDFPaBrndRca
transaction
38222914e6014c72478ef7b83ba56d2229ca00502663928c945fb9570e9c6634
spent
true